粉煤加压气化工艺采用CO_2和N_2输煤的对比及选择  被引量:4

Comparison and Selection of CO_2 and N_2 as Pulverized Coal Carrier Gases in Coal Gasification Process

摘  要:对粉煤加压气化中分别采用CO_2输煤和N_2输煤的两种工艺进行了分析比较,结果表明:采用CO_2输煤比采用N_2输煤的操作费用会降低约4%,投资高3%。并由此总结出了煤化工装置不同产品应选用不同的输煤工艺及适合的流程配置的规律。Analysis and comparison of the C〇2 and N2 as pulverized coal carrier gases in coal gasification process usher the results that compared with the latter, applying the former one can decrease the operating cost by 4% and increase the investment by 3% . A rule is summed up therefrom that different pulverized coal carrier gases and applicable processes shall be selected for different products of coal chemical units.
